Requirements are only loosely defined in Scrum and should be reviewed and clearly defined before entering a sprint. This is done during the current sprint in a ceremony called Product Backlog Refinement.

Impact studies determine one important factor: change. New policies are implemented to foster a change within the system to benefit individuals or an organisation. They measure the result of change from new policy. These types of studies inform policy makers about potential economic, social, and environmental effects
